你有没有试过试图解释“加密数据还能做计算”这种事?我有一次试着跟朋友聊FHE(全同态加密),结果对方一脸茫然,最后总结:“所以就是魔法?”好吧,确实有点像魔法,但最近看到Zama @zama_fhe 团队的最新进展后,我觉得这个“魔法”离我们的日常生活又近了一步——现在他们居然把TFHE(基于环的全同态加密)的bootstrapping速度压到了不到1毫秒!



简单说,FHE的核心在于你可以对加密数据进行计算,而不用解密。这听起来很酷,但实际操作时有个大问题:加密数据每做一次计算,噪声都会增加,导致数据变得越来越难处理。这时候需要“重置”噪声,也就是所谓的bootstrapping。这个过程过去超级慢——早期版本在CPU上需要53毫秒,而现在,Zama用GPU把这个时间压缩到了945微秒,快了56倍。这不仅是个技术突破,还意味着FHE离实际应用更近了。

为什么这事重要?想象一下,在区块链上用FHE处理交易数据——你的隐私完全保护,但计算速度却接近明文数据处理。这对金融、医疗甚至AI代理都有巨大意义。Zama的团队通过优化算法和GPU资源,让TFHE在性能和安全性之间找到了平衡。比如,他们采用了多位算法(multi-bit algorithm),让GPU的并行能力发挥到极致,同时保持128位安全性和极低的失败概率(2^-128)。这听起来很专业,但核心就是:快、稳、隐私友好。

更有趣的是,这种优化不仅限于单次计算。如果你需要处理大批量数据,TFHE的架构可以轻松扩展到多GPU环境——比如在一台配备8块H100 GPU的机器上,它每秒可以完成189,000次bootstrapping。相比2021年的性能,这提升了2554倍!这让我不禁想问:如果未来有专用硬件(比如FHE加速器),这个速度会不会再翻几倍?

当然,FHE还不是万能的。它在区块链上的应用还面临其他瓶颈,比如网络通信和零知识证明的效率。但随着技术的进步,像Zama这样的团队正在让“魔法”变成现实。或许有一天,我们真的能轻松聊起FHE,而不再需要解释它是“魔法”。你觉得呢?
post-image
此页面可能包含第三方内容,仅供参考(非陈述/保证),不应被视为 Gate 认可其观点表述,也不得被视为财务或专业建议。详见声明
  • 赞赏
  • 评论
  • 转发
  • 分享
评论
0/400
暂无评论
交易,随时随地
qrCode
扫码下载 Gate App
社群列表
简体中文
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)